Software Developer: Pioneering the Digital Future

The software development field remains a cornerstone of the remote work revolution. Developers are responsible for building everything from mobile apps to enterprise-level systems, and as technology continues to evolve, the demand for skilled developers is only increasing. In 2025, remote software development will continue to offer high-paying opportunities, with companies looking for developers who can innovate, troubleshoot, and create cutting-edge products.

A strong grasp of programming languages is essential for a successful career in software development. Key languages such as Python, JavaScript, and Java are in high demand. Familiarity with development frameworks like React, Angular, and Node.js is also critical for building scalable applications. Additionally, developers need to be proficient in version control systems like Git and GitHub, ensuring smooth collaboration with remote teams. As more companies transition to cloud-based solutions, knowledge of cloud technologies such as AWS, Google Cloud, and Azure is becoming increasingly important.

The salary range for remote software developers is typically between $90,000 and $160,000 per year, depending on experience and expertise. Developers specializing in high-demand fields like artificial intelligence (AI) or blockchain can command even higher salaries. The role remains popular because it offers excellent pay, high job security, and the flexibility to work remotely from anywhere in the world.

Digital Marketing Specialist: Driving Business Growth in a Virtual World

With the digital landscape evolving at a rapid pace, businesses are relying more heavily on remote digital marketing specialists to help them navigate the complex world of online advertising, SEO, social media, and content creation. Digital marketing professionals are responsible for driving online traffic, converting visitors into customers, and ensuring brands remain visible and relevant in a competitive online marketplace.

In 2025, the skills needed to thrive as a remote digital marketing specialist are vast and diverse. Knowledge of search engine optimization (SEO) and search engine marketing (SEM) remains fundamental, as these techniques help businesses improve their rankings on search engines like Google. Additionally, a strong command of content creation and marketing strategies, including blogging, social media management, and email marketing, is essential. A deep understanding of data analytics tools, such as Google Analytics or SEMrush, allows digital marketers to track campaign performance and adjust strategies accordingly.

Remote digital marketing roles offer an attractive salary range of $60,000 to $110,000 annually, with the potential for higher earnings for those specializing in areas like pay-per-click advertising or SEO. As eCommerce continues to grow and companies increasingly rely on online marketing strategies, remote digital marketing professionals will continue to be in high demand, making it a lucrative and flexible career option.

Cybersecurity Specialist: Protecting the Digital World

As cyber threats become more sophisticated, the need for remote cybersecurity specialists is more critical than ever. Cybersecurity professionals are tasked with protecting an organization’s sensitive data, networks, and systems from potential breaches. With the rising number of cyberattacks and data breaches, the role of a cybersecurity expert is one of the most important in ensuring the safety and integrity of digital operations.

Cybersecurity specialists in 2025 are expected to have a broad skill set. Understanding cybersecurity frameworks, such as NIST and ISO 27001, is essential for implementing effective security measures. Professionals should also be well-versed in network security, including firewalls, intrusion detection systems, and secure communications protocols. As cyber threats evolve, specialists must also have a strong understanding of encryption techniques and risk management strategies to safeguard sensitive information. Knowledge of compliance regulations like GDPR and HIPAA is also crucial for ensuring businesses adhere to legal and ethical standards.

Salaries for remote cybersecurity specialists typically range from $100,000 to $170,000 per year, with senior-level positions or roles in high-risk industries commanding even higher pay. This field remains highly popular due to the growing need for digital security in virtually every industry, offering both job stability and high earning potential.

UX/UI Designer: Crafting Seamless Digital Experiences

User experience (UX) and user interface (UI) designers are at the forefront of the digital design process, ensuring that websites, apps, and software are not only functional but also intuitive and visually appealing. With more businesses focusing on creating exceptional online experiences for their customers, remote UX/UI designers are in high demand, particularly in 2025 as businesses invest in digital transformation.

To succeed in remote UX/UI design, professionals must have a strong foundation in both creative and technical skills. UX designers focus on user research, wireframing, prototyping, and testing to ensure that digital products are user-friendly and meet the needs of their target audience. UI designers, on the other hand, concentrate on the visual aspects of digital products, such as layout, color schemes, typography, and interactive elements. Familiarity with design tools like Sketch, Figma, and Adobe XD is essential for both roles.

Remote UX/UI designers can expect to earn anywhere from $70,000 to $120,000 annually, with the potential for higher earnings in senior positions or for those specializing in areas like mobile app design or complex enterprise systems. As businesses continue to prioritize customer experience and user-centered design, remote UX/UI design roles will remain highly lucrative and popular.
